Multiple directory traversal vulnerabilities in help/help.php in Interact Learning Community Environment Interact 2.4.1 allow remote attackers to include and execute arbitrary local files via a .. (dot dot) in the (1) module and (2) file parameters.

CWE-22 Improper Limitation of a Pathname to a Restricted Directory ('Path Traversal')
The product uses external input to construct a pathname that is intended to identify a file or directory that is located underneath a restricted parent directory, but the product does not properly neutralize special elements within the pathname that can cause the pathname to resolve to a location that is outside of the restricted directory.
